123458212 发表于 2023-7-7 05:44:11

用CodeSys配置机器人的步骤:如何轻松完成机器人的配置

文章大纲:

一、机器人的概述

二、CodeSys是什么?

三、机器人的配置步骤

    1. 编写程序
   
    2. 配置运行环境
   
    3. 设定通讯参数
   
    4. 烧录程序到控制器
   
    5. 运行机器人

四、使用CodeSys进行机器人编程的优势

    1. 易于学习
   
    2. 提高编程效率
   
    3. 高度可靠性
   
    4. 支持多种编程语言
   
    5. 灵活性强
   
五、CodeSys常见问题解决方法

    1. 程序无法烧录
   
    2. 通讯故障
   
    3. 程序调试不顺利
   
六、总结

注:字数超过3000字

详细编写文章内容:

一、机器人的概述

机器人是电气工程及其自动化领域中的重要研究方向。在工业生产线上,机器人可以替代人工完成重复性的劳动任务,从而提高生产效率和质量。同时,在其他领域,如医疗、服务等方面,机器人也呈现出越来越广阔的应用前景。

二、CodeSys是什么?

CodeSys 是一种流行的基于 IEC 61131-3 标准的工业自动化开发环境。它支持多种编程语言和 PLC 硬件,并提供了一个用户友好的编程界面和一个强大的调试器。在机器人领域,CodeSys 可以使用其卓越的功能和性能,轻松地进行程序设计和编码。

三、机器人的配置步骤

在使用 CodeSys 进行机器人编程前,我们需要先对机器人进行配置。以下是机器人的配置步骤:

1. 编写程序:在 CodeSys 中,可以通过图形化的方式进行编程。根据机器人的运动逻辑,通过编写程序实现机器人的功能。

2. 配置运行环境:在配置运行环境时,我们需要选择机器人所需的硬件和软件版本。同时,还需要设置机器人的 CPU 主频和内存大小。

3. 设定通讯参数:在机器人的通讯方面,我们需要设定其 IP 地址、端口号和通讯协议等参数。这样,机器人才能与其他设备进行正常通讯。

4. 烧录程序到控制器:当进行完程序编写和设置后,我们需要将程序烧录到机器人的控制器中。这可以通过串口和 USB 等通讯方式进行。

5. 运行机器人:完成上述步骤后,我们即可开始使用机器人了。在运行中,我们可以通过监控系统来实时监测机器人的状态和输出结果。

四、使用CodeSys进行机器人编程的优势

在使用 CodeSys 进行机器人编程时,有如下几个优势:

1. 易于学习:CodeSys 的开发环境友好且直观,新手可以快速熟悉它的语法和功能。

2. 提高编程效率:CodeSys 可以自动创建共享变量和程序模块,同时也支持多线程编程,从而大大提高编程效率。

3. 高度可靠性:CodeSys 在编程时,可以对程序进行强制类型转换,从而可以避免很多代码错误,同时还具有强大的调试功能,可以快速解决问题。

4. 支持多种编程语言:CodeSys 支持多种编程语言,如 Structured Text, Instruction List, Function Block Diagram 等,使开发者可以选择最适合项目的语言。

5. 灵活性强:CodeSys 可以与多种 PLC 硬件兼容,能够在不同平台之间进行编程和数据交换,具有很高的灵活性。

五、CodeSys常见问题解决方法

在使用 CodeSys 进行机器人编程时,可能会出现以下几个常见问题:

1. 程序无法烧录:这种情况通常是由于硬件和软件版本不兼容或其它设置错误导致。解决方法可通过确认版本是否正确,检查程序代码等方式来解决。

2. 通讯故障:机器人无法与其他设备进行通讯,可能是由于通讯参数设置有误或者通讯协议不兼容等原因。需要先进行通讯参数检查,修正错误后再试。

3. 程序调试不顺利:在 CodeSys 中进行程序调试时,可能会遇到各种问题,如变量未定义、数据类型不匹配等。解决方法主要是对程序进行逐步调试,通过打印日志等方式找出问题并进行修复。

六、总结

通过本文的介绍,我们可以了解到使用 CodeSys 配置机器人的步骤以及使用 CodeSys 进行机器人编程的优势。同时,我们还介绍了一些常见的问题及相应的解决方法。在未来的电气工程及其自动化领域中,CodeSys 将会变得越来越重要,尤其在机器人方面。

________________________________________________________________________

免责声明:本文非官方发布,内容真实性请注意甄别,文章内容仅供参考。本站不对内容真实性负责,请悉知!本站不对内容真实性负责,请悉知!。我们专注于汇川技术产品培训,官网https://shicaopai.com

shicaopai 发表于 2023-8-6 13:57:53

CodeSys配置机器人的步骤:如何轻松完成机器人的配置

使用CodeSys进行机器人编程是一种流行的方法,它基于IEC 61131-3标准,并提供了一个强大而功能丰富的开发环境。通过CodeSys,可以轻松地进行机器人的配置和编程,从而实现机器人的自动化控制。

本文将介绍CodeSys配置机器人的详细步骤,并讨论使用CodeSys进行机器人编程的优势。同时,还将提供一些常见问题的解决方法。

一、机器人的概述

机器人是电气工程及其自动化领域中的重要研究方向。它们可以用于工业生产线上替代人力完成重复性任务,提高生产效率和质量。此外,在医疗和服务等领域,机器人也有广泛的应用前景。

二、CodeSys是什么?

CodeSys是一种常用的工业自动化开发环境,基于IEC 61131-3标准。它支持多种编程语言和PLC硬件,并提供用户友好的编程界面和强大的调试功能。在机器人领域,CodeSys可以帮助实现机器人的编程和控制。

三、机器人的配置步骤

使用CodeSys进行机器人的配置通常需要以下步骤:

1. 编写程序:根据机器人的运动逻辑,通过CodeSys在图形化界面中编写程序,实现机器人的功能。

2. 配置运行环境:选择适合机器人的硬件和软件版本,并设置CPU主频和内存大小等参数。

3. 设定通讯参数:设置机器人的IP地址、端口号和通讯协议等参数,以实现与其他设备的通讯。

4. 烧录程序到控制器:使用串口或USB等通讯方式,将编写好的程序烧录到机器人的控制器中。

5. 运行机器人:完成上述步骤后,可以开始使用机器人。通过监控系统,实时监测机器人的状态和输出结果。

四、使用CodeSys进行机器人编程的优势

使用CodeSys进行机器人编程具有以下优势:

1. 易于学习:CodeSys具有直观友好的开发环境,新手可以快速上手,并熟悉其语法和功能。

2. 提高编程效率:CodeSys自动生成共享变量和程序模块,并支持多线程编程,大大提高了编程效率。

3. 高度可靠性:CodeSys可以进行强制类型转换,避免很多代码错误,并具有强大的调试功能,能够快速解决问题。

4. 支持多种编程语言:CodeSys支持多种编程语言,如结构化文本、指令列表、功能块图等,开发者可以选择最适合项目的语言。

5. 灵活性强:CodeSys与多种PLC硬件兼容,能够在不同平台之间进行编程和数据交换,具有很高的灵活性。

五、CodeSys常见问题解决方法

在使用CodeSys进行机器人编程时,可能会遇到以下常见问题:

1. 程序无法烧录:这可能是由于硬件和软件版本不兼容或设置错误导致的。解决方法包括确认版本是否正确、检查程序代码等。

2. 通讯故障:机器人无法与其他设备进行通讯,可能是由于通讯参数设置有误或通讯协议不兼容引起的。解决方法包括检查通讯参数并修正错误。

3. 程序调试困难:在CodeSys中调试程序时,可能会遇到变量未定义、数据类型不匹配等问题。解决方法包括逐步调试程序,并通过打印日志等方式找出问题并修复。

六、总结

本文介绍了使用CodeSys配置机器人的步骤,并讨论了使用CodeSys进行机器人编程的优势。同时,提供了一些常见问题的解决方法。在电气工程及其自
                                                                                                                                                                                                                                                 以上内容来自AI机器人,如需继续对话,则在此回答下“点击回复” 或者 在提问时“@机器人”!禁止 "黄赌毒及政治敏感",违者封号,严重者 提交 网警公安部门。本站不对内容真实性负责,AI机器人有时候会乱说一通……
页: [1]
查看完整版本: 用CodeSys配置机器人的步骤:如何轻松完成机器人的配置